305 W Lea Blvd, Wilmington, DE, 19802 (current address)
PO Box 8323, Wilmington, DE, 19803 (2009 - 2018)
16 Amstel Dr, New Castle, DE, 19720 (2007 - 2012)
1115 Nfranklin St, Wilmington, DE, 19806 (2010)
PO Box 29544, Washington, DC, 20017 (2008 - 2009)
2251 Sherman Ave NW, Washington, DC, 20001 (2005)
2251 Sherman Avemue, Washington, DC, 20001 (2004)
305 W 37th St, Wilmington, DE, 19802 (1996 - 2002)
PO Box 305, Wilmington, DE, 19899 (2000)